| Chemical Type | Styrene–Ethylene/Butylene–Styrene (SEBS) triblock copolymer |
| Product Form | Pellets |
| Appearance | Off-white to light beige, free-flowing cylindrical pellets |
| Primary Applications | Thermoplastic elastomer compounding, soft-touch overmolding, flexible packaging |
| Key Features | High elasticity, excellent processability, oil resistance, PP/PS compatibility |
| Benefits | Reduced energy consumption during processing, recyclable, no vulcanization required |
| Recommended Drying | 60–80 °C for 2–4 hours prior to processing |
| Storage Conditions | Keep in dry, cool, well-ventilated area; avoid direct sunlight and moisture |
